Unexpected transformation of a diamagnetic Mo3(μ3-S)(μ-S)3 to a paramagnetic Mo3(μ3-S)2(μ-S)3cluster core by reaction of [Mo3S4(dppe)3Br3]PF6 with tBuSNa†‡
Alexander V. Virovets,Antonio Alberola,Rosa Llusar
Dalton Transactions Pub Date : 08/20/2010 00:00:00 , DOI:10.1039/C0DT00675K
Abstract

The electron precise [Mo33-S)(μ-S)3(dppe)3Br3]+ incomplete cuboidal complex with six cluster skeletal electrons (CSE) can be converted to the paramagnetic bicapped [Mo33-S)2(μ-S)3(dppe)3]+ cluster with an unusual seven metal electron population by treatment with tBuSNa, which simultaneously serves as a reducing agent and a source of the additional capping sulfur atom.
